Hyacinthus orientalis, 1806

Illustration of Hyacinthus orientalis, commonly known as hyacinth. Hand-coloured lithograph on paper by Sydenham Edwards, 1806.
Artwork from Curtiss Botanical Magazine, volume 24, plate 937. Curtiss Botanical Magazine is the longest running botanical periodical featuring colour illustrations of plants and has been published continuously since 1787
